Chief Master Sergeant Michael E. Delgiacco Retired from the U.S. Air Force in 2017 with over 37 years faithful service to his country. Now retired and working for the Airlines, Mike has joined the Patriots Honor team providing returning veterans an opportunity to attain dramatic improvement in both physical mobility and mental well-being.

Chief Master Sergeant Michael E. Delgiacco was the acting Superintendent of the 349 Operations Group, Travis AFB CA. As the Group Superintendent, he advised the Group Commander and seven Squadron Commanders on organizing, training, equipping, and developing 350 Airmen from a variety of career fields. He led an enlisted leadership team comprised of nine CEMs and seven First Sergeants in identifying and addressing health, morale, and welfare concerns affecting the quality of life of Airmen assigned to the group and wing. In addition, Chief Delgiacco interpreted and enforced applicable policies and directives and establishes control procedures to meet mission goals and standards. He recommends ways to improve organizational effectiveness and efficiency to group commander and ensures assigned personnel and resources are managed in support of the group and wing missions.

A native of Braintree, Massachusetts, Chief Delgiacco entered the United States Air Force in 1980. He began his career as an aircraft maintenance technician where he maintained C-5A, C-5B, C-5C and C-141B aircraft. In 1991, he cross-trained as a flight engineer to operate the C-5 aircraft, where he served as an Air Reserve Technician Flight Engineer. In 2005, the Chief transitioned to the KC-10A aircraft. During his career, he has flown more than 9,500 hours in tanker and airlift aircraft.
